Postpartum Fitness: One Mom's Journey to Recovery Nine weeks after giving birth, Shannon, a pediatric occupational therapist and mother of two from the US, is sharing her postpartum fitness journey. She gained 35 pounds during her pregnancy, a weight gain she acknowledges as within the normal range. However, she is actively working to regain her strength and health. "The number on the scale is scary," Shannon admits, "but I also want to be a healthy model for my boys, make sure I’m eating enough food to keep up my breastmilk supply, and get my strength back up!" She says that the common belief that weight melts off while breastfeeding didn't hold true for her. This time around, Shannon is prioritizing her health with a multi-pronged approach. She's engaging in pelvic floor physical therapy, consulting with a registered dietician, and meeting with a talk therapist every other week.
